About Do photovoltaic solar panels work hot
Solar panels perform optimally in moderate temperatures up to 77°F. Generally, a panel’s efficiency degrades as temperature increases over 77°F. A solar panel’s temperature coefficient indicates how well it performs in less-than-ideal conditions (such as temperatures above 77°F).

Do solar panels work best in hot weather?
It’s easy to assume that solar panels work best in hot, sunny environments like deserts, where the sun is blazing all day. However, heat can actually reduce solar panel efficiency. Solar panels are electronic devices, and just like computers and other electronics, they operate more efficiently in cooler temperatures.
How hot do solar panels get?
Generally, solar panel temperature ranges between 59°F (15°C) and 95°F (35°C), but they can get as hot as 149°F (65°C). However, the performance of solar panels, even within this range, varies based on temperature and product. What happens if a photovoltaic panel gets hot?
But the hotter the panel is, the greater the number of electrons that are already in the excited state. This reduces the voltage that the panel can generate and lowers its efficiency. Higher temperatures also increase the electrical resistance of the circuits that convert the photovoltaic charge into AC electricity.
Why are solar panels hotter than external temperature?
Because the panels are a dark color, they are hotter than the external temperature because dark colors, like black, absorb more heat. For example, the ambient temperature in the desert can reach 113 degrees Fahrenheit, meaning solar panels in this climate can reach 149 degrees Fahrenheit.
